METHODS AND SYSTEMS FOR MAKING OFFERS BASED ON CONSUMERS' PRICE DISCRIMINATION
Granted: December 12, 2013
Application Number:
20130332301
Techniques are provided which allow users to view historical price information for a product, and which allow users to specify a desired purchase price. Historical price information may be collected and displayed to the user in a graphical format. The user may specify a desired purchase price that the user is willing to pay for the product. The user provided price may be presented to a seller of the product. The user may be targeted with an offer to purchase the product at the user…
USER VACILLATION DETECTION AND RESPONSE
Granted: December 12, 2013
Application Number:
20130332285
An embodiment of the present invention automatically detects when a user is in a state of vacillation based on user on-line behavior, records relevant parameters regarding the vacillation event, and then responds accordingly. This response may include providing relevant and/or targeted information that can be used by the user to help remove the indecision. The response may also or alternatively include providing third-party businesses, such as retailers, marketers, and advertisers, with…
METHOD AND APPARATUS FOR ADVERTISEMENT DELIVERY
Granted: December 12, 2013
Application Number:
20130332269
Provided is an advertisement delivery method for delivering an advertisement for causing a user terminal, which transmitted an access request to a web site via a link set in an advertisement, to transmit an access request to the web site again. The advertisement delivery method includes acquiring, by a computer, a behavior pattern of the user terminal in the web site, and delivering to the user terminal, by the computer, a different advertisement depending on the behavior pattern by…
MOBILE MONETIZATION
Granted: December 12, 2013
Application Number:
20130332266
A device, system, and method are directed towards facilitating monetization of mobile devices. A click action server determines click actions that are to be sent to a client device based on one or more factors. The click actions are sent to the client device as links. An action handler receives requests indicating a selected action, and facilitates the performance of the action.
RELATIVE EXPERTISE SCORES AND RECOMMENDATIONS
Granted: December 5, 2013
Application Number:
20130325779
Content recommendations customized to a user's knowledge are provided. The user's knowledge is assessed from the user's activity history and the expertise of the user regarding each of the various topics relative to a cohort group is determined. Based on the user's score, the user can be classified into various competency levels ranging from a novice to an expert in each topic. Content items for improving the user's scores in the various topics can be forwarded based on the user's…
PERSONALIZED CONTENT FROM INDEXED ARCHIVES
Granted: December 5, 2013
Application Number:
20130326406
Personalized content is generated from different media items using a content index. The content index is generated or updated by identifying segments of media items that are of particular interest to users. User interactions with the media items are analyzed and metadata of segments of media items that are determined to be of particular interest to the users is recorded. The parameters associated with a request for personalized content for a user are matched with the recorded metadata to…
INFORMATION PROCESSING APPARATUS, COMMUNICATION SYSTEM, AND COMMUNICATION METHOD
Granted: December 5, 2013
Application Number:
20130326027
An information processing apparatus is connected to and communicates with a terminal connected to a first communication network and a second communication network based on a predetermined communication protocol. The first and the second communication network are operable using the predetermined communication protocol. The second communication network is a closed communication network. The information processing apparatus includes first and second communication units. The first…
SYSTEM AND METHODS FOR PROVIDING CONTENT
Granted: December 5, 2013
Application Number:
20130325897
Method, system, and programs for generating questions for a user. A request for content from a user is received via the communication platform. The content is retrieved from a content source. A question is generated for the user based on the content requested by the user and a history of previous information accessed or posted by the user. The question is sent to the user.
CREATING A CONTENT INDEX USING DATA ON USER ACTIONS
Granted: December 5, 2013
Application Number:
20130325869
Personalized content is generated from different media items using a content index. The content index is generated or updated by identifying segments of media items that are of particular interest to users. User interactions with the media items are analyzed and metadata of segments of media items that are determined to be of particular interest to the users is recorded. The parameters associated with a request for personalized content for a user are matched with the recorded metadata to…
METHOD AND SYSTEM FOR PRESENTING QUERY RESULTS
Granted: December 5, 2013
Application Number:
20130325838
Method, system, and programs for presenting query results are disclosed. An input is received from a user related to a search query. A first set of query results and a second set of query results are then obtained based on the search query. A query intent is detected based on the search query. A first presentation style associated with the detected query intent is determined for the first set of query results. The first and second sets of query results are provided to the user. The first…
SYSTEM FOR PROVIDING CONTENT
Granted: December 5, 2013
Application Number:
20130325601
A computer-implemented method serves content to a device. The method includes identifying a characteristic of content displayed with a first device. Through the use of a processor, the characteristic is compared with a campaign constraint of an advertising campaign that includes an advertisement. The method includes transmitting the advertisement to a second device for display when the characteristic satisfies the campaign constraint.
SPONSORED APPLICATIONS
Granted: December 5, 2013
Application Number:
20130325594
A computer-implemented method for sponsored applications includes: loading a smart tag with metadata about an application to be downloaded on a user device, said metadata including information about the application that assists an ad server in selecting a targeted advertisement relevant to said application; programming the smart tag to communicate with the ad server requesting service of relevant, targeted ads to the user device based on the metadata once the application is transmitted…
CENTRALIZED AND AGGREGATED TRACKING IN ONLINE ADVERTISING PERFORMANCE PREDICTION
Granted: December 5, 2013
Application Number:
20130325590
The present invention provided techniques that may be used, for example, in online advertising. Techniques are provided that include centralized and aggregated advertisement performance data tracking, which can be used in advertisement selection. Advertisement performance data may be obtained by a central server, such as from many advertisement servers. The central server may aggregate the performance data, and may generate a performance snapshot spanning many advertisements. The…
AUTOMATIC TAG EXTRACTION FROM AUDIO ANNOTATED PHOTOS
Granted: December 5, 2013
Application Number:
20130325462
A system and method for assigning one or more tags to an image file. In one aspect, a server computer receives an image file captured by a client device. In one embodiment, the image file includes an audio component embedded therein by the client device, where the audio component was spoken by a user of the client device as a tag of the image file. The server computer determines metadata associated with the image file and identifies a dictionary of potential textual tags from the…
RELATIONSHIP DISCOVERY ENGINE
Granted: November 28, 2013
Application Number:
20130317937
A system, method, and computer program product discover relationships among items and recommend items based on the discovered relationships. The recommendations provided by the present invention are based on user profiles that take into account actual preferences of users, without requiring users to complete questionnaires. An improved binomial log likelihood ratio analysis technique is applied, to reduce adverse effects of overstatement of coincidence and predominance of best sellers.…
METHOD AND SYSTEM FOR GENERATING RECIPIENTS WHILE COMPOSING ELECTRONIC MAILS
Granted: November 28, 2013
Application Number:
20130318175
A computer-implemented method of generating recipients while composing electronic emails includes identifying a trigger from a user in response to the user composing an electronic mail (email). The computer-implemented method also includes receiving one or more alphabets subsequent to the trigger. The alphabets imply a recipient of the email. Further, the computer-implemented method includes fetching email addresses comprising the one or more alphabets from an address book corresponding…
METHOD AND SYSTEM FOR EMAIL SEQUENCE IDENTIFICATION
Granted: November 28, 2013
Application Number:
20130318172
A system and method for identifying causal email threading. In one aspect, a computing device identifies a plurality of email templates, each email template corresponding to characteristics of a received machine-generated email, the characteristics of the received machine-generated email relating to static data of the machine-generated email. The computing device generates a template causality graph by analyzing the plurality of email templates to determine a statistical causality…
BEHAVIORAL TARGETING SYSTEM
Granted: November 28, 2013
Application Number:
20130318024
A behavioral targeting system determines user profiles from online activity. The system includes a plurality of models that define parameters for determining a user profile score. Event information, which comprises on-line activity of the user, is received at an entity. To generate a user profile score, a model is selected. The model comprises recency, intensity and frequency dimension parameters. The behavioral targeting system generates a user profile score for a target objective, such…
DIFFERENTIAL DEALS IN A THEME GROUP
Granted: November 21, 2013
Application Number:
20130311258
Techniques are provided for offering a deal to a group of users, and for determining differential discounts for the users of the group that participate in the deal. A deal is offered to users of a group of users formed in association with a corresponding topic. Each user of the group is enabled to selectively accept the deal. The deal is confirmed with a plurality of users of the group that accepted the deal. Discounts for the deal are differentially assigned to the plurality of users…
CREATING VIDEO SYNOPSIS FOR USE IN PLAYBACK
Granted: November 21, 2013
Application Number:
20130308921
Implementing a video synopsis includes using a playback device configured to: receive a video for playing on the playback device; generating a synopsis index of video clips from the video; playing the video until the play is suspending before reaching an end of the video; checkpointing the location in the video timeline at which the video play was suspended; and storing the checkpointed location.